Gray Code Technology

Gray code (also known as reflected binary code) is a binary numeral system where two successive values differ in only one bit. This encoding method provides significant advantages for position feedback:

  • Error Reduction: Only one bit changes at a time, eliminating ambiguous readings during transitions
  • Noise Immunity: Reduces errors caused by electrical noise or timing skew in multi-bit signals
  • Absolute Position: Provides position information immediately upon power-up without homing sequence
  • High Reliability: Ideal for safety-critical applications requiring fault-tolerant position sensing

Troubleshooting Guide

Symptom Possible Cause Solution
No position feedback Encoder cable disconnected, power supply issue Check cable connections, verify encoder power supply voltage
Erratic position readings EMI interference, loose connections, encoder fault Route encoder cable away from power cables, check terminal tightness, test encoder
Position jumps or skips Mechanical coupling issue, encoder damage Inspect encoder mounting and shaft coupling, replace encoder if damaged
Incorrect position scaling Configuration error, wrong encoder resolution Verify encoder specifications, reconfigure scaling parameters in DCS
